    Government: Duty is to uphold the law

    Re: “To sit or stand: Trump’s challenge to Democrats a key moment in State of the Union address” (Feb. 25, Nation):

    President Donald Trump scolded Democrats for not standing during the State of the Union address when he said, “The first duty of the American government is to protect American citizens. Not illegal aliens.”

    Democrats need to defend their position, and it goes like this: The duty of the government is to uphold the law. Homes cannot be searched without a warrant, and people cannot be snatched off the street by unidentified masked agents for having exercised free speech, whether they are citizens or not. The inscription on the Supreme Court building says, “Equal Justice Under Law.”

    Harry Stern, Seattle
